Understanding the LASIK Treatment and First Recuperation



When you undergo LASIK, you're picking a popular and effective technique to deal with vision problems. This outpatient procedure uses a laser to improve your cornea, allowing light to concentrate appropriately on your retina. The surgical treatment itself commonly takes just about 15 minutes per eye, and you'll observe an enhancement in your vision virtually promptly.

Throughout the first recovery stage, your eyes may feel a bit scratchy or watery, however this typically subsides within a couple of hours.

It's essential to rest your eyes and avoid stressing them with screens or bright lights. Your physician might recommend eye decreases to assist recovery and minimize pain.

Follow their instructions carefully to ensure a smooth recuperation and attain the best feasible results from your LASIK experience.

Essential Eye Care Products for Post-Surgery



After your LASIK procedure, having the right eye treatment items handy can significantly boost your recuperation experience.

Initially, obtain preservative-free fabricated tears to maintain your eyes damp and comfortable. You could additionally intend to buy a set of high quality sunglasses to protect your eyes from brilliant lights and UV rays when you tip outside.

Furthermore, have a pack of cold compresses ready to help in reducing any kind of swelling or pain. Keep in mind to stock up on any type of suggested eye decreases, as these are critical for protecting against infection and promoting recovery.

Finally, think about making use of a sleep mask to secure your eyes while you rest, guaranteeing a calm recovery.

Managing Pain and Side Effects



Even in a comfy healing space, you may experience some discomfort and side effects after your LASIK treatment. It's typical to feel a gritty experience in your eyes, as if there's sand in them. Over the counter painkiller can help manage this discomfort, however constantly consult your doctor first.

You might also see fuzzy vision or halos around lights; do not stress, as these signs should enhance over time. Keep your eyes lubed with the prescribed man-made tears to reduce dry skin.



Remember to stay clear of massaging your eyes and put on sunglasses outdoors to protect them from intense light and wind. Staying hydrated and relaxing can also assist in your healing.

Listen to your body and connect to your medical professional if discomfort persists.

Follow-Up Appointments and What to Anticipate



As you recuperate from LASIK, going to follow-up consultations is critical for checking your healing process and guaranteeing your vision boosts as expected.

Normally, you'll have a follow-up within the initial day or 2 after surgery, after that at one week, one month, and perhaps three months post-op. During these gos to, your ophthalmologist will examine your vision, assess healing, and deal with any concerns you might have.

You could undergo various tests, consisting of measuring your visual acuity and checking for any signs of problems. It is necessary to be truthful about any type of symptoms you're experiencing.

These consultations aid your physician make necessary modifications to your recovery strategy, making sure the very best possible end result for your vision.

Tips for a Smooth Shift Back to Daily Activities



After your follow-up appointments, it's time to progressively ease back right into your daily tasks. Start with light tasks, avoiding laborious exercise or hefty lifting for a minimum of a week.

Pay attention to your body; if you really feel pain, take a break. Limitation screen time initially to minimize eye stress, and bear in mind to take frequent breaks making use of the 20-20-20 regulation-- consider something 20 feet away for 20 seconds every 20 mins.

Avoid swimming pools, jacuzzis, and dirty atmospheres for a couple of weeks to shield your eyes. Put on sunglasses outdoors to secure against UV rays and wind.

Stay moisturized and follow your physician's post-operative instructions carefully. With persistence and care, you'll shift smoothly back to your regular!
